- Grant Description
- Purpose. This NIH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A), supported by funds provided to the NIH under the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act of 2009 (Recovery Act or ARRA), Public Law 111-5, invites Research Project Cooperative Agreement (UC4) applications from organizations that propose to study the impact of clinical decision support systems in disseminating and increasing the consideration of comparative effectiveness research findings. The purpose of this FOA is to implement and assess real-time decision support systems, which if effective, could be broadly adopted. Mechanism of Support. This FOA will utilize the UC4 grant mechanism Funds Available and Anticipated Number of Awards. NIBIB intends to commit up to $3,000,000 total funds under this FOA. We anticipate that 2 awards may be made for fiscal year 2010, pending the number and quality of applications and availability of funds.
